Pegasystems (PEGA) FY Conference Transcript
2025-08-13 14:57
Summary of Pegasystems (PEGA) FY Conference Call - August 13, 2025 Company Overview - **Company**: Pegasystems (PEGA) - **Industry**: Workflow and work automation technology - **Key Focus**: Helping large organizations modernize their workflow applications and transition to cloud-based solutions [3][4][5] Core Insights and Arguments - **Market Position**: Pegasystems targets large companies, typically those with revenues above $1 billion, which often manage thousands of applications [3][4] - **Transition to Cloud**: The company has shifted from a perpetual license model to a recurring subscription model, with over 50% of clients now on Pega Cloud, up from less than 5% seven years ago [5][6] - **ACV Growth**: Annual Contract Value (ACV) grew by 14% year-over-year in constant currency, with Pega Cloud's ACV growing 25% year-over-year [8][15] - **Total Addressable Market**: The total addressable market is estimated to be around $100 billion annually, with significant opportunities for growth as many clients still rely on legacy systems [11][12][14] - **Legacy System Challenges**: Many clients face issues with outdated applications that are costly to maintain and unable to leverage modern technologies like GenAI [12][13][18][60] Financial Performance - **Free Cash Flow**: The company generated $286 million in free cash flow in the first half of 2025, ahead of expectations, with a guidance of $440 million for the year [24][26] - **Tax Benefits**: Recent legislative changes allow for immediate expensing of R&D, potentially increasing free cash flow by $25 to $30 million in 2025 and 2026 [28][29] Sales and Marketing Strategy - **Sales Organization Changes**: Significant restructuring of the sales organization occurred in late 2022 and early 2023 to improve efficiency and target the right organizations [35][36] - **Customer Acquisition Cost (CAC)**: The company aims to achieve a CAC ratio of 2 to 2.5, indicating a focus on efficient sales growth [38][39] Generative AI Integration - **Pega GenAI Blueprint**: A new solution designed to accelerate application design and development using GenAI, which is provided free to clients to encourage adoption [41][42][48] - **Market Impact**: Early indications show that GenAI Blueprint is positively impacting client engagement and sales momentum [50] Legacy Transformation Opportunity - **Market Potential**: The majority of clients are still in the early stages of cloud migration, with estimates suggesting they are only 10-25% through their journey [58][59] - **Long-Term Strategy**: Pegasystems aims to assist clients in overcoming legacy debt and modernizing their applications efficiently [60] Conclusion - **Future Outlook**: Pegasystems is well-positioned to capitalize on the significant market opportunities presented by the need for modernization and cloud migration among large enterprises, with a strong focus on leveraging GenAI to enhance their offerings and client engagement [11][12][14][50][60]
PEGA Surges 14%: There's Still Time to Ride This GenAI Innovator
MarketBeatยท 2025-07-27 15:44
Core Insights - Pegasystems has exceeded Wall Street expectations for the second consecutive quarter, with shares rising 14% following strong Q2 results [1][3] - The company's GenAI Blueprint product is gaining traction and is positioned to capitalize on the evolving AI landscape [1][6] Financial Performance - In Q2, Pegasystems reported sales of nearly $385 million, reflecting a growth rate of 9.5%, surpassing estimates by approximately $40 million [3] - Adjusted earnings per share (EPS) were $0.28, indicating a growth rate of 7.7%, contrary to analysts' predictions of a decline [3] - The annual contract value (ACV) growth rate stands at 14%, providing a more accurate assessment of future revenue potential compared to revenue growth alone [4] Product and Market Dynamics - The ACV growth rate for Pegasystems' Pega Cloud offering is notably higher at 25%, as the company transitions customers to its managed cloud services [5] - The net new ACV additions reached $99 million in the first half of 2025, marking a 60% increase compared to the same period in 2024 [6] GenAI Blueprint Impact - The GenAI Blueprint tool allows users to quickly generate application blueprints to address business problems, significantly reducing development time [6][8] - This tool is integral to Pegasystems' sales strategy, enhancing customer engagement and facilitating deal closures [8][9] - The successful implementation of GenAI in application design provides Pegasystems with a competitive edge in the market [9] Future Outlook - Analysts have raised their price targets for Pegasystems following the Q2 results, with an average target of $65.60, suggesting a potential upside of around 13% [10] - The company is in the early stages of the Blueprint rollout, indicating significant long-term growth potential as it targets legacy systems [11][12] - The GenAI Blueprint is proving to be a key growth driver, resonating well with customers and creating investment opportunities [13]
Pegasystems Affirms Outlook As Cloud Strategy Powers Momentum
Benzingaยท 2025-07-24 18:27
Core Insights - Pegasystems Inc. (PEGA) exceeded expectations in its fiscal second-quarter 2025 results, showcasing strong momentum driven by its cloud strategy [1][3] - The company reported total revenue of $384.5 million, a 9% year-over-year increase, surpassing analyst estimates [3][4] - Cloud revenue surged by 24% year-over-year, reaching $166.7 million, which constitutes 43% of total revenue [4][5] Financial Performance - Annual Contract Value (ACV) rose 16% year-over-year to $1.514 billion, exceeding the estimated $1.476 billion [4][6] - Pega Cloud ACV increased by 28% year-over-year, reaching $761.1 million, indicating a shift from on-premise to cloud-based deployments [5][6] - Recurring maintenance revenue was $79.3 million, slightly above the projection of $76.5 million, while term license revenue was $74.6 million, down 6% year-over-year but beating estimates [6] Guidance and Future Outlook - The company reaffirmed its fiscal 2025 guidance, projecting 12% ACV growth, total revenue of $1.7 billion (up 7% year-over-year), and $440 million in free cash flow [7][8] - Analysts expect Pegasystems to generate $452.2 million in free cash flow for fiscal 2025, translating to a 27% free cash flow margin [8] - The company is well-positioned for long-term growth, with strong momentum in its cloud business and reduced legal risks [9]

Here's What Key Metrics Tell Us About Pegasystems (PEGA) Q2 Earnings
ZACKSยท 2025-07-22 23:31
Core Insights - Pegasystems reported revenue of $384.51 million for the quarter ended June 2025, reflecting a year-over-year increase of 9.5% and surpassing the Zacks Consensus Estimate by 4.27% [1] - The company's EPS for the quarter was $0.28, up from $0.26 in the same quarter last year, exceeding the consensus estimate of $0.24 by 16.67% [1] Revenue Breakdown - Subscription services revenue was $246.01 million, below the average estimate of $251.35 million, but showed a year-over-year increase of 14.7% [4] - Subscription license revenue reached $79.96 million, exceeding the average estimate of $53.75 million, but represented a decline of 5.5% compared to the previous year [4] - Total subscription revenue was $325.98 million, surpassing the average estimate of $305.08 million, with a year-over-year growth of 9% [4] - Perpetual license revenue was reported at $0.71 million, significantly higher than the average estimate of $0.07 million, marking a year-over-year increase of 1875% [4] - Maintenance revenue was $79.27 million, falling short of the average estimate of $106.67 million [4] - Consulting revenue was $57.82 million, slightly above the average estimate of $54.62 million, with an 11.1% increase year-over-year [4] - Pega Cloud revenue was $166.74 million, below the average estimate of $172.96 million [4] Stock Performance - Pegasystems' shares have returned +2.8% over the past month, compared to a +5.9% change in the Zacks S&P 500 composite [3] - The stock currently holds a Zacks Rank 1 (Strong Buy), indicating potential for outperformance in the near term [3]

Pega Cloud Drives Subscription Revenues: Will It Aid PEGA's Growth?
ZACKSยท 2025-07-07 17:36
Core Insights - Pegasystems (PEGA) is experiencing accelerated growth in its cloud segment, with Pega Cloud's Annual Contract Value (ACV) increasing by 23% year-over-year to $701 million in Q1 2025, driven by demand for AI-powered, cloud-native solutions [1][3] - The company's cloud revenues rose 15% year-over-year to $151.1 million, highlighting the strength of its recurring revenue model [1][9] - Pegasystems aims to grow Cloud ACV by 20% or more, supported by successful cross-selling, upselling, and new client acquisitions [3][9] Cloud Momentum - There is a clear shift among enterprises towards scalable and intelligent automation, with PEGA's AI-infused platforms simplifying digital transformation and enhancing client retention [2] - The increase in ACV indicates deeper customer engagement and more durable multi-year contracts as workloads transition from legacy systems to the cloud [2] Competitive Landscape - Salesforce (CRM) is a strong competitor in cloud-native CRM and low-code workflows, leveraging its extensive integrations and partnerships to enhance its market position [5] - Oracle (ORCL) competes with PEGA in process automation, excelling in infrastructure and large-scale deployments, while PEGA stands out in BPM usability and AI-driven decision-making [6] Stock Performance and Valuation - Pegasystems shares have gained 16% year-to-date, outperforming the broader Zacks Computer and Technology sector, which returned 8.2%, and the Computer-Software industry, which rose 17% [7][9] - The Zacks Consensus Estimate for PEGA's earnings is $1.88 per share for 2025, reflecting a year-over-year growth of 24.5% [11]
Pegasystems (PEGA) Update / Briefing Transcript
2025-06-02 20:00
Summary of Pegasystems (PEGA) Investor Session - June 02, 2025 Company Overview - **Company**: Pegasystems (PEGA) - **Event**: Investor Session - **Date**: June 02, 2025 Key Points and Arguments Company Strategy and Differentiation - **AI Integration**: The company emphasizes the importance of using AI to design specific workflows rather than relying solely on textual prompts for automation. This approach aims to enhance reliability and predictability in business processes [9][11][12]. - **Workflow Engine**: Pegasystems has a state-of-the-art workflow engine that integrates AI to facilitate conversational interactions while maintaining workflow integrity [12][16]. - **Center Out Architecture**: The architecture allows for a unified approach to business processes, ensuring consistent outcomes across different customer channels [18][19]. Market Opportunity - **Market Size**: The addressable market for Pegasystems is estimated to be around $90 billion, potentially growing to $150 billion in the coming years, indicating a double-digit growth rate [70][74]. - **Cloud Adoption**: There is a significant trend towards cloud migration, with expectations that 80% of enterprise applications will be cloud-based within the next five to seven years [75][76]. - **Legacy Transformation**: Many companies are still on legacy systems, and Pegasystems positions itself as a leader in addressing the challenges of legacy transformation [77][78]. Product Innovations - **Blueprint Technology**: The introduction of Blueprint technology is highlighted as a game changer for legacy transformation, allowing for rapid ideation and workflow creation [30][80]. - **Partner Collaboration**: Pegasystems is collaborating with major partners like Accenture to create branded blueprints that leverage their unique intellectual property [82][84]. - **Pricing Model**: A new pricing model allows customers to access up to 80,000 pieces of work for as little as $60,000 a year, making it more accessible for a broader range of clients [29].
